Cameron Weldon & George Thorpe BBC News, Devon BBC The Red Arrows are set to feature during this year's English Riviera Airshow Pilots hope they can inspire future generations to take to the skies as they soar above the crowds of the English Riviera Airshow. The 2025 edition of the event which takes over the skies above the seafront at Paignton Green is set to begin on Friday and continue until Sunday with thousands of spectators expected to attend. The RAF's Red Arrows and Typhoon display teams are among those showing of their skills in the air. Flt Lt Ollie Suckling of the Red Arrows said the team was looking forward to performing for the crowds as he had fond memories of watching air shows as a child himself. "I've got stuff back at home signed by the Red Arrows from my local air show when I was growing up," he said. "It's really good to be able to give something back and think you might be talking to someone who might be in the Red Arrows in 20 or 30 years time." Flt Lt Suckling added the display would have a lot of colour, power and noise along with a "little surprise" for the crowd. He said: "We are painting the sky and hopefully everyone will enjoy it." 'Career highlight' Another of the pilots who will be taking to the skies is Sqn Ldr Nathan Shawyer, from Honiton, who will fly an RAF Typhoon. He said: "It's an immense privilege and I cannot wait to come home. "To be back in that neck of the woods and see everyone again will be a career highlight for sure."
